Fear and Loathing in Assignments.
Iv now found out what is required for part of the assessments, not good news, 4 lesson plans, cycled as part of a SOW all under the banner of blended learning. Enough to make me as sick as i was last week...
With time not on my side this is my idea,
It is my one and only idea...
Get my learners to carry out some Market Research for the Routes shop that they run in the reception area at the Barons Court site. Aim to discover what customers would like to see in the shop, cereal bars, stationary, that sort of thing....
Week 1 Lesson
- Students to set up blogs,
- Use blogs to come up with questions for survey etc.
Week 2 Lesson,
-Finalize questions in blogs
-use www.surveymonkey.com to design question layout, for example multiple choice q's.
-Feedback survey progress into blogs.
Week 3 Lesson,
- Send out survey electronically, All staff list, All students.
- Look into podcasting and set up an account.
Week 4 Lesson,
- Look at the results collected so far,
-podcast the success or failure of the project so far.
-Update blogs, pose questions like 'are we getting the results we had hoped for?'
Week 5 Lesson,
- Pod cast the final results,
- Conclude Market Research in blog discussion.
And that is that....
